Leah, who has been torn between her loyalty to Pope and her connection to Daryl, is forced to make a pivotal choice. When Pope orders a hwacha (a cart mounted with rocket-propelled arrows) to be fired into the courtyard, knowing it will kill both the walkers and his own men, Leah realizes that Pope's leadership is toxic.
The mid-season finale of The Walking Dead Season 11, Episode 8, titled "For Blood," delivers a high-stakes, action-packed hour that leaves several major storylines hanging in the balance.
